Goa, a former Portuguese colony in India famous for its golden-sand beaches, fascinating parties, red-hot nightlife, and fun culture. It is one of the most popular chilling destinations for Indian and Foreign tourists alike.

This destination is entertained by people throughout the year. It draws attention not just by its exquisite coastlines but also by its freakish Portuguese architecture, cuisine, churches, and forts. Being located in the Western Ghats, it holds in its beauty some of the vibrant biodiversity hotspots of the world.

1. Baga Beach

If you haven’t been to Baga beach, you haven’t been to Goa. This busy beach, located in North Goa, is a hotspot for seafood, sunbathe, and water sports. It is famous for its motorboats, paragliding, parasailing, and dolphin cruises in the daylight. But the fun never ends on Baga beach. The nighttime is even more enjoyable with its sizzling parties. So if you are a party animal, this place is your jungle.

2. Dudhsagar Waterfalls

One of the splendiferous sites to visit in Goa is this four-tiered waterfall located in the Mandovi River. It is one of the tallest waterfalls in India at the Goa-Karnataka border. Dudhsagar has melting milky white water and softening greenery which is blissful to watch. It presents beautiful sightseeing when the Mandovi River falls

into the Arabian Sea. Located amongst the Bhagwan Mahaveer Sanctuary and Mollem National Park, the waterfall is surrounded by plushy biodiversity. It is a must-visit if you’re in Goa. (Don’t forget to book your advance trips. It is a busy location).

3. Vagator Beach

Located in the northernmost Goa across the river Chapora, Vagator Beach is famous for its popular red cliffs, spellbinding sunset views, and non-stop rave parties. This clean, calm, and cozy beach is a perfect spot to spend your time with friends. You can also go for water sports close to the beach. If your visit is to fall on Saturday, you can enjoy being in one of Goa’s biggest Flea markets put up by the Germans. At Vagator beach, you will cherish the leisurely strolls while seeing the beauty of the diverse landscapes around.

4. Aguada Fort

Fort Aguada is an iconic 17th-century Portuguese fort that is located in North Goa. It has an old-fashioned four-story lighthouse standing tall at the Sinquerim Beach, which gives a captivating view of the Arabian Sea and a more stunning view of the sunset. The fort was built in 1612 for defense against the Dutch and Marathas. It was also used as a prison cell and even has a secret passage gate for escape. This place is one of the fine pieces of Portuguese architecture.

5. Basílica de Bom Jesus

This Roman Catholic basilica, located in Old Goa, one of the oldest and most famous tourist attractions and a UNESCO World Heritage Site since 1999. It was built in the 16th century and is a mix of Doric, Corinthian, and the Baroque style of architecture. This Basilica is famous for holding a 400-years old mummy of St.Francis Xavier. This Portuguese colonial architecture is a must-visit seven wonders of Portuguese origin in the world.

6. Wax Museum

Are you all-time crazy about celebrities and famous personalities? Well, you may find some of them in the museum. Wax World Museum is at a 4-min walking distance from the Basicila de Bom Jesus. It is a small museum featuring wax statues of Indian historical figures and celebrities. With wax statues of more than 200 personalities, this place also plays a 12D show for its visitors. Also, if you’re accompanying kids, they will enjoy being here.

7. Ancestral Goa Museum

Coming to Goa and not exploring what Goan people looked like ages ago won’t serve the purpose. Ancestral Goa Museum, also known as Big Foot Museum, is a theme park located in South Goa. This fascinating museum depicts rural Goa’s history, culture, folklife, and festivals. The miniature artifacts showing traditional Goa are informative and a delight to watch. You can also bring back souvenirs from the handicrafts store in the museum.

8. Dr.Salim Ali Bird Sanctuary

Located in the Charo Island along the river Mandvi, Dr.Salim Ali Bird Sanctuary is a place you would love to visit early in the morning. This place has a variety of birds like chirping western reef herons, red knot, jack snipe, and many more. This mangrove habitat is also home to flying foxes, crocodiles, and jackals. You can easily reach the bird sanctuary through a ferry service. Visit the place and cherish the leisurely strolls while seeing the beauty of nature in this secluded place away from the party life of Goa.

9. Mahadev Temple

This well-preserved, stone-carved, 12th-century temple is built in the Kadamba style architecture and is dedicated to Lord Shiva. Located in Tambdi Surla, it is an ASI-protected Monument of National Importance. According to some legends, this place still houses a king cobra, a snake adorned by the Hindu God Shiva. Visit this temple to admire the unique carvings in the inner sanctum along with the peace around it.
